Supplementary Report

From Mackay, 10.12.13

Stewards inquired into the performance of World Quality. Trainer L. Wright could offer no explanation regarding the disappointing performance. He advised that the horse has since been transferred to another stable.

Stewards permitted trainer D. Symons to remove the tail chain from Cailin Mor after advising stewards he had removed this with RISA. Upon checking with RISA, it was established that Mr Symons had not removed the tail chain prior to acceptances for this meeting, and was subsequently fined $400. (AR140B)

Race 1: Carlton & United Maiden Plate - 1100m
1st Cloudy Night 2nd Risani 3rd Sole Survivor 4th- Pure Widow

Due to transport difficulties, trainer C. Thompson arrived late on course 30 minutes prior to this race.

DAZZLING MAGIC refused to load and was declared a late scratching at 1.03 pm.

CONDAMEERA was fractious in the barriers and injured jockey D. Simmons, and was subsequently scratched at 1.05 pm. A warning was placed on CONDAMEERA regarding its barriers manners.

Subsequent to the event all monies invested on DAZZLING MAGIC and CONDAMEERA were ordered to be refunded and the following deductions applicable:

Deductions applicable on the late scratching of Dazzling Magic at 1.03 pm.

6 cents in the dollar for the win of Cloudy NIght
6 cents in the dollar for place of Cloudy NIght
7 cents in the dollar for 2nd place Risani
16 cents in the dollar for 3rd place Sole Survivor

Deductions applicable between 1.03 pm and the late scratching of Condameera at 1.05 pm.

0 cents in the dollar for the win of Cloudy Night
2 cents in the dollar for place of Cloudy NIght
7 cents in the dollar for 2nd place Risani
5 cents in the dollar for 3rd place Sole Survivor

Starting prices were subject to deduction.

At the start, RISANI (A. Coome) and PURE WIDOW (A. Allen) bumped.

Shortly after the start, BELLA ROCKET (C. Pye) commenced to buck and took no competitive part in the race.

At the 400m, SOLE SURVIVOR (M. Usher) had to be steadied when IF ONLY THEY KNEW (T. O'Hara) shifted in slightly.

IF ONLY THEY KNEW raced wide throughout.

Connections of DAZZLING MAGIC and BELLA ROCKET were advised each must obtain 2 barrier certificates prior to racing again.

Following the incident in the barriers, Jockey D. Simmons was transported to hospital for observation. He was advised that a medical certificate would be required prior to him resuming race riding. Riding changes were made as per the Stewards Summary Sheet.

Race 4: Caneland Central Benchmark 60 H'cap - 1300m
1st Savasha 2nd Thankgodforfranc 3rd Sweet Taboo 4th- Brochette

Stewards accepted the explanation tendered by trainer R. Walsh for the late declaration of riders for SAMMY JUNIOR and KEY TO THE CAN.

J. Felix was the replacement rider for HELP ME RHONDA.

On return to scale, jockey A. Coome, rider of the 2nd placegetter, THANKGODFORFRANC, lodged a protest against SAVASHA (K. Aho) being declared the winner, alleging interference at approximately the 300m. After taking evidence from the parties concerned and viewing the patrol films, stewards were satisfied that the interference suffered by THANKGODFORFRANC did not warrant a reversal of the placings and the protest was dismissed. Near the 300m, SAVASHA (K. Aho) shifted in marginally, resulting in THANKGODFORFRANC being held up on the heels of SAMMY JUNIOR (S. Wilson). Shortly after, SAVASHA rolled out, slightly impeding THANKGODFORFRANC. Apprentice K. Aho, rider of SAVASHA, was advised to exercise more care when shifting ground.

SWEET TABOO (L. Dillon) and KEY THE CAN (J. Babarovich) began awkwardly.

BEDROCK BETTY (T. O'Hara) was slow to begin.

Approaching the 400m, SWEET TABOO (L. Dillon) had to be steadied from the heels of WEATEHRVANE (M. Usher), which shifted in slightly.

WEATHERVANE raced wide throughout.
